Understanding the Basics of China Solar System 800V MCCB

Understanding the China Solar System 800V MCCB is essential for those in the solar energy sector. The MCCB, or Molded Case Circuit Breaker, plays a critical role in ensuring the safety and efficiency of solar power systems. With a rating of 800V, this special circuit breaker is designed to handle high voltages, making it suitable for modern solar installations. It protects electrical systems from overload and short circuits, reducing the risk of damage.

When considering purchasing an MCCB, it’s important to assess your specific needs. Look into factors such as voltage ratings, current capacities, and environmental conditions. Ensure the product meets relevant safety standards. Pay attention to the certification marks. This indicates that the device has undergone rigorous testing for reliability and performance.

Key Features and Benefits of 800V MCCB in Solar Applications

The 800V MCCB (Molded Case Circuit Breaker) is increasingly important in solar energy systems. Its high voltage rating is crucial for modern solar applications. This device ensures safety and reliability, protecting against overloads and short circuits effectively.

One standout feature is its compact design, which allows for efficient space utilization in solar inverters. Its response time is rapid, contributing to system stability. Additionally, the 800V MCCB can cater to various environmental conditions, making it versatile for different installations. The ability to handle high inrush currents is also a significant benefit, as solar systems often experience fluctuating loads.

How to Select the Right 800V MCCB for Your Solar System

Selecting the right 800V MCCB (Molded Case Circuit Breaker) for your solar system is crucial. In recent years, the renewed energy sector has seen a surge, with solar energy projects increasing by over 20% annually. This growth translates to greater demand for reliable circuit protection technology.

When choosing an 800V MCCB, consider the specific requirements of your solar system. Look for features such as short-circuit protection and overload capabilities. The device’s rated current should align with your system's maximum output. According to industry reports, the right MCCB can improve overall system efficiency by up to 15%.

It's also essential to assess the environment where the MCCB will be installed. If exposure to moisture or dust is likely, opt for a device with a higher ingress protection rating.
